How it works
Adding a ledger is essential to record transactions associated with a property. You can create a new ledger via the listing or the accounting section, depending on the use case.
Tip: We recommend enabling Auto Ledger Creation in Settings > Accounting > Accounts, so you only need to create ledgers manually in exceptional cases.
Create a ledger via a listing
To create a new ledger via a listing:
- Go to: Properties
- Select the listing
- Click on Accounting > Trust
- Click Add Ledger
The ledger details will appear.
- If a ledger has not yet been created for the listing, Enter the ledger name
- Click Save
Create a ledger via the Accounting menu
To create a new ledger via Accounting menu:
- Go to: Accounting > Trust > Ledgers
- Select + New Ledger from the top right corner of the screen
- Enter the Ledger Name
- Select the Ledger Type
- Search for the Property and select it to link the ledger to that property
- Search for the Vendor(s) and select them from the results to link the ledger to the contacts
- Search for the Purchaser(s) and select them from the results to link the ledger to the contacts
Note: Add a purchaser only if the ledger is for a property sale. For rentals, deposits, or general trust accounting, you can create the ledger with just the vendor and leave out the purchaser.
- Select an Account
- Click Save
